A Casting Director Once Told Lana Condor to 'Be More Like Hello Kitty'
LatestLana Condor, star of Netflix’s To All the Boys I’ve Loved Before, has been talking in films since she was cast in 2016’s X-Men: Apocolypse, but apparently at some point, a casting director thought she would be better at acting if she could more closely imitate the mannerisms of a mouthless cat.
Condor didn’t tell Teen Vogue what she was auditioning for when given that directive but does say that she did not take it:
“I remember when she said that, I just was like, ‘I don’t know what you mean.’ I straight up — you kind of have to call that out,” she said, adding “Also, Hello Kitty doesn’t have a mouth. [So as] a woman, I’m like, ‘One, you want me to be more like Hello Kitty, but she doesn’t have a voice.’ That’s so insulting to me.”
Not only does Hello Kitty not have a mouth, but she also does not have any real characteristics besides being cute and the product of a Japanese company, though Hello Kitty’s bio does state she was born in England and is a Scorpio with Type A blood.
